# Applicant Portal:## Job Details: Business Development Executive - Moorings| | Business Development Executive - Moorings || | Intermoor, Acteon’s Moorings and Anchors business line, provides project and operational management expertise to customers across the mooring lifecycle. By combining operational knowledge of mooring equipment, anchor handling, and industry failure modes with subsea engineering expertise, we create a company unmatched within the mooring niche. This approach mitigates risks in delivery, installation, and operations across the lifecycle, reducing mooring lifecycle costs and safeguarding major operations that protect start-up schedules when mooring and mooring intervention are on the project or production critical path.
